Amelioration of high-fat diet (hfd) + ccl4 induced nash/nafld in cf-1 mice by activation of sirt-1 using cinnamoyl sulfonamide hydroxamate derivatives: in-silico molecular modelling and in-vivo prediction

HIGHLIGHTS

  • who: Nalini Sodum from the Department of Pharmacology, Manipal College Education, Manipal, Karnataka, India have published the Article: Amelioration of high-fat diet (HFD)u2009+u2009CCl4 induced NASH/NAFLD in CF-1 mice by activation of SIRT-1 using cinnamoyl sulfonamide hydroxamate derivatives: in-silico molecular modelling and in-vivo prediction, in the Journal: (JOURNAL)
  • what: This study was carried out using different in-silico tools such as molecular docking and molecular dynamics from Schru00f6dinger, maestro, LLC software. This study was designed to check the effect of cinnamyl sulfonamide hydroxamate derivatives for treating NASH.
